Choosing the Best Binoculars for Kids

Introducing children to bird watching is a fantastic way to spark their curiosity about nature. The right binoculars can make the experience fun and rewarding, helping kids see birds up close with ease. When selecting binoculars for young birders, here are the key factors to consider:

What to Look for in Kids’ Binoculars

1. Lower Magnification (6x or 7x)

High magnification makes binoculars harder to steady. A 6x30 or 7x35 pair provides enough zoom while keeping the image stable.

2. Lightweight & Compact Design

Kids need binoculars that are easy to carry and hold for long periods. Look for models under 20 ounces with an ergonomic grip.

3. Wide Field of View

A broader field of view helps children track moving birds more easily. Lower magnification models naturally provide a wider view.

4. Durability & Safety

A rubber-coated exterior helps protect against drops and bumps. Soft eyecups make them comfortable and safe for little users.

5. Easy Focus Adjustment

Look for binoculars with a simple focus wheel and adjustable eyepieces to accommodate different eye distances.
